MS SB2945
Bill
AI Summary
-
Authorizes the City of Greenwood to levy an additional tax of up to 2% on gross room rental proceeds from hotels and motels (10+ guest rooms), in addition to the existing 1% tax authority.
-
Requires the City Council to adopt a resolution declaring intention to levy the additional 2% tax and mandates a voter election where 60% of qualified electors voting in favor are needed to approve the tax.
-
Requires notice of the proposed tax to be published for at least 3 consecutive weeks in a newspaper, with first publication at least 21 days before the election and last publication no more than 7 days before.
-
Allocates tax proceeds (less 3% retained by Department of Revenue for collection costs) to the Greenwood Tourism Commission for promoting conventions and tourism, with annual minimum donations of $2,000 to Thompson Clemons Post 200 American Legion and $5,000 to R & M Productions.
-
Repeals the act effective September 30, 2017.
